If I could imagine a world in which my wife enjoyed whiskey this is the bottle I pick as her favorite. Red Breast or let’s just say it, “Robbin,” is an Irish whiskey, 12 years old and 55.8%. Irish whiskey is unique in the way it’s distilled; they use a pot still, which embarks more flavor and mouthfeel on the palate. It’s an old school method, more costly, and messier than your traditional column distillation. However, this Redbreast is amazing, even with the higher proof; you don’t taste the burn in your throat like other higher proofs.

I rarely give flavor notes when I drink whiskey because taste is subjective and I don’t want to come off as I prick if I taste something you don’t. That being said, many people find notes of biscuit, butter, and softer bready flavors on the pallet. I could get behind those notes but let’s be clear.
